Runbook: Furrowlink telemetry gateway. Ingests sensor packets from field units over MQTT; auth via per-device certs rotated quarterly. If the gateway drops connections, check the cert-expiry dashboard first — most incidents are rotation failures, not attacks. Do not disable TLS verification under any circumstances; use the quarantine broker for suspect devices. Cert rotation procedure, device allowlist, and escalation contacts are documented on the internal page here.

operations page: https://jenkins.zemvarcloud.local/job/merge_requests/repo/build/73930b4b30f0a8ed

## Authentication

Heads up: the nightly reindex job (`reindex_nightly.py`) talks to the Lanternfish search cluster, and that cluster won't accept anonymous writes anymore — we locked it down last sprint. The job now authenticates as the `reindex-runner` service identity against Corvid Gateway, and the token is injected via the `LF_INDEX_TOKEN` env var in the scheduler config. Nothing clever going on, just a bearer header on every batch request. For review purposes, the staging credential currently in use is listed below.

service key, kadug-kadup: kto15_rN23XLAYImmZgrJ

### First-Day Checklist — Night Shift: Bike Cage & Parking Gates

Before your first night shift at the Thornmere Depot, confirm your vehicle details with the shift coordinator so the number-plate reader at Gate C recognises you. The bike cage sits behind Gate C, left of the generator shed; cyclists must use the pedestrian wicket, never the vehicle barrier, as the sensor cannot detect bikes after dark. Lock frames to the rails, not the mesh. Both the wicket and the cage door open with the same keypad entry, given below.

turnstile pass: bdg-FVNQRS-72965873

## Hot-reload procedure — Kestrelbox

Kestrelbox watches its config directory and reloads within five seconds of a write, without restarting workers. Support should verify the reload log line before declaring a change applied; partial writes are rejected atomically. The reloadable configuration values currently in effect are the following.

deployment values, bahap-bahip:
[eliath]
team = gorius
access_code = ac_9ce55b
owner = holion.eliius
host = eliath.nelvrohq.internal
port = 8443
peer = kaswyn.merlaqlabs.test
salt = 01afd960
pin = 5193